Njoroge understands Hall’s decision

Njoroge

Sofapaka defender John Njoroge believes former coach Stewart John Hall is well advised to make a return to Tanzanian outfit Azam, the team he had parted ways with before signing with Sofapaka.

Hall made the return to Tanzania after leading Sofapaka for just over a month and the left back admits  that in the business of football no one can be faulted for moving where there is a better deal and wished the Englishman all the best.

Greener pastures

-I hear that the Tanzanians offered a good deal so I fully understand him. That is the nature of football though we will miss him here. In this business you get attracted to the best offer; we always look for greener pastures.

-I wish him the best in his new job, he told futaa.com.

Hall managed just one win in the league with the 2009 Tusker Premier League (TPL) champions.
